Herzl is a Yiddish-German diminutive built on Herz, “heart,” with the South German/Austro-Bavarian suffix -l, yielding the affectionate sense “little heart” or “dear heart.” Through Ashkenazi usage it entered Modern Hebrew as הרצל (pronounced HER-tsel). As a personal name it functions mainly in Jewish communities, where the warm meaning and compact form made it a natural given name or nickname.

Its modern prominence stems from the legacy of Theodor Herzl, the founder of political Zionism; from the early 20th century many Jewish families bestowed Herzl to honor him, and it remains a recognizable, if uncommon, Israeli male name. Common variants and transliterations include Hertzel, Herzel, and Hertsel; Herzi serves as a colloquial pet form. Related surnames are Herz and Herzl. Note that it is etymologically distinct from Hersh/Herschel (from German Hirsch, “deer”). The name carries connotations of devotion, courage, and heartfelt commitment.
